Ensuring health requirements are met is an important aspect of making sure your child is ready for school. Madison County School nurses are responsible for monitoring several student health requirements including immunizations, physicals and dental/vision exams. The nurses also provide staff with trainings for certain health conditions and medication administration, assist with meeting the needs of student IEPs/504 plans and collaborate with agencies in the community to provide health education as needed for our students.
